• Never use the Unio-868 when it has been taken from a
cold to a warm room. The resulting condensation may
destroy the Unio-868. First let the product reach room
temperature without switching it on.
• Do not touch the Unio-868 and the mains plug of the de-
vice that you want to plug in to the Unio-868 with moist
or wet hands!
• Only load the Unio-868 to the indicated power limit.
Overload may cause destruction, fire or electrical ac
-
cident.
• Before each use, check the Unio-868 for damage. If you
find any damage, the Unio-868 must not be connected
to the mains voltage. There is a danger to life!
• Before cleaning, disconnect the Unio-868 from the mains
socket and any connected device from the Unio-868.
• Clean the Unio-868 with a dry and lint-free cloth, which
may be moistened slightly in case of severe contamina-
tion, and only after disconnection from the mains outlet.
Do not use any solvent-containing cleaning agents for
cleaning. The plastic housing and labels may be at-
tacked.
2.2 Requirements for the personnel
• Each person who is tasked to work with the Unio-868
must have read the complete Operating Instructions and
have understood the dangers resulting from the use of
device before performing any activities.
2.3 Safety instructions for operation
• You have to check the casing and the connected con-
sumers for damage prior to the commissioning and
regularly afterwards as well. Never commission a dam-
aged Unio-868.

Product description
3.1 General information
The Unio-868 is an easy to handle radio switching outlet
with many usage options that permits the comfortable wire-
less switching of electric mains-powered devices across
large distances. The Unio-868 has (bidirectional) routing
functions.
The Unio-868 is connected between the outlet of the electri-
cal household installation and the electrical consumer to
be controlled. Only such devices must be used that have a
mains plug and mains voltage range that fits the specifica
-
tions of the Unio-868. The connected consumer must not
exceed the maximum switching output of the Unio-868.
The environment for intended application of the Unio-868 is
the residential and business area, as well as small industry.
The Unio-868 must not be used to control devices where
malfunction may cause a danger to persons, animals or
property.
Interferences from other radio and telecommunication
systems that work on the same frequency band cannot be
fully excluded.
Radio operation is only permitted with released transmitters.
